Getting Started: Installation and Access
The first thing to consider is how you get onto the platform. With the SpinBoss app, you’ll need to download it from the official website (since it’s not on mainstream app stores). This takes a few minutes and requires you to adjust your device settings to allow installations from unknown sources. Once installed, the app sits on your home screen, ready to launch with a tap.
Using the browser, on the other hand, is instant. Just type the URL into Chrome, Safari, or any other browser, and you’re in. No downloads, no storage space taken up, and no permission changes. For players who like to dip in and out quickly, the browser wins on convenience.
Performance and Speed
When it comes to performance, the app often has the edge. Because it’s built specifically for mobile devices, it can optimise graphics and loading times. Games tend to run smoother, and you’ll experience fewer lag spikes, especially on older phones. The browser version is still responsive, but it relies on your internet connection and browser capabilities. If you have a slower connection, the app may provide a more stable experience.
However, the browser has its own advantage: it’s always up to date. You never have to worry about downloading the latest version; the site updates automatically. With the app, you’ll need to manually update it when a new version is released, which can be a minor hassle.

User Interface and Navigation
The SpinBoss app is designed with touchscreens in mind. Buttons are larger, menus are simplified, and navigation feels natural. The browser version is also mobile-friendly, but it’s essentially the desktop site shrunk down. Some elements might be smaller and require more precise tapping. If you’re on a tablet or desktop, the browser version is perfectly fine. On a phone, the app provides a more polished experience.
Security and Trust
Both platforms use the same encryption and security protocols. Your personal and financial data is protected whether you play via app or browser. The app does have one slight advantage: it can’t be spoofed by phishing sites as easily, since you’re launching it directly. With the browser, you need to ensure you’re on the correct URL. Always double-check before logging in.
